How to prepare for a job interview at Lounge Underwear Ltd.
β¨Know Your Ingredients
Make sure youβre well-versed in the fresh ingredients youβll be working with. Research seasonal produce and be ready to discuss how you would incorporate them into your dishes. This shows your passion for quality and your commitment to using the best available options.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Head Chef, youβll be leading a team, so be prepared to share examples of how youβve successfully managed kitchen staff in the past. Talk about how you motivate your team, handle conflicts, and ensure everyone is working towards the same high standards.
β¨Emphasise Food Safety Knowledge
Food safety is crucial in any kitchen. Brush up on food hygiene regulations and be ready to discuss how you maintain these standards in your kitchen. Highlight any certifications you have and how you implement safety practices in your daily operations.
β¨Prepare for Practical Demonstrations
You might be asked to demonstrate your cooking skills during the interview. Be ready to showcase your techniques and creativity. Practise a few signature dishes that highlight your style and ability to work under pressure, as this will impress your potential employers.
